When the cryptocurrency entrepreneur Eric Schiermeyer heard that President Trump was holding small group dinners with major donors, he saw opportunity.
Mr. Schiermeyer reached out to a lobbyist with connections in Mr. Trump’s orbit, who arranged for him to attend a dinner with the president at his private Mar-a-Lago club on March 1 in exchange for donations to a pro-Trump PAC called MAGA Inc. totaling $1 million.
The personal and corporate donations were among dozens of seven- and eight-figure contributions to MAGA Inc. from crypto and other interests revealed in a campaign finance filing on Thursday night that hinted at the access Mr. Trump accords those willing to pay.
At the dinner, Mr. Schiermeyer, who had never given a federal political donation before, presented an idea for a cryptocurrency called β€œU.S.A. Token” that would be distributed to every citizen, according to interviews and a flier he distributed to attendees that sets out details of the proposal. He hoped it could be su

Cryptocurrency interests, which have benefited from the Trump administration’s dismantling of a yearslong government crackdown and from the Trump family’s financial interest in the industry, appear to have been the most generous industry, accounting for nearly $45 million in donations to MAGA Inc.An affiliate of the exchange Crypto.com gave $10 million, while the crypto services company Blockchain.com donated $5 million. The venture capitalists Marc Andreessen and Ben Horowitz, who are heavily invested in crypto, gave $3 million each. Ondo Finance, which has a partnership with the Trump family’s crypto company, donated $2.1 million to MAGA Inc., on top of $1 million to Mr. Trump’s inauguration.
